THE COMPANY
Duel was founded by world-record-breaking adventurer and former brand ambassador Paul Archer, alongside viral games developer Naio Tsarouchis. They set out to develop both the technology and methodology that enables purpose-led brands to drive organic growth, powered by real communities of advocates.
Duel is on a mission to create and own the Brand Advocacy category of marketing and fulfil our purpose of tipping the focus from shareholder return to people and the planet. We want everyone to win, brand and customer alike.
Duel’s Brand Advocacy Platform allows mid-level to enterprise brands to do just that - scaling how they manage their relationships with thousands of advocates and brand ambassadors. This unprecedented ability to manage their communities is built around programs that engage and retain customers, accelerating word-of-mouth sales.
The Duel team is made up of psychologists, brand experts and community builders from companies including Amazon, Treatwell, Bain and Lululemon. The platform is used by brands such as Monica Vinader, Charlotte Tilbury, Rab, BeautyPie, KUHL, Tropicfeel and many more.
Duel is also especially proud of being featured in Gartner’s ‘Cool Vendor’ Retail Marketing category.
THE ROLE
As you can probably tell, at Duel, we are obsessed with helping our brands get organic growth through the word-of-mouth of their happy customers. At the core of this principle is providing a remarkable customer experience. We take that to heart with our own customers, who have now become the primary channel for our own growth.
You’ll manage a breath of incredible D2C brands and work closely with various stakeholders within the customer base, providing the strategic view of our Brand Partners and driving customer experience. Ensuring every Brand Partner is successful with the Duel technology and is happy can’t live without it.
Strategic Vision
Maintaining a strategic vision of Duel’s entire customer base in order to drive customer adoption and satisfaction and work towards 100% retention
Identifying opportunities and proposing solutions to Brand Partners to support them in getting the most out of their advocacy programs
Understanding the competitive landscape and sector relevant information to keep Duel’s Brand Partners informed
Staying up to date on market trends within the consumer marketing world - creating and identifying advocacy opportunities within our client base
Collaboration
Collaborating with Duel Product Management on market-led requirements and priorities for inclusion within the product roadmap—creating an optimal feedback loop between our product and our customers
Working closely with the Duel development team to provide technical support for customers and feedback on new features or products, becoming an integral part of steering the direction of the product
Working with Account Managers and Strategists within the sales cycle to establish customer goals, evaluate their needs and suggest optimisation techniques or additional features to meet their requirements
Brand Management
Maintain relationships with operators of the Duel platform from our Brand Partners (clients) and advise and educate them on the technology to bring each Advocacy Program to life
Serve as the primary regular point of contact for both internal and external stakeholders throughout the entire relationship between Duel and a Brand.
Guide customers through the onboarding and technical implementation phase, which will involve empathising on a personal level with the individual you are assisting from the brand, as well as with the strategy of the brand and their goals.
